I. Types of Monitoring Equipment:

Before delving into setup procedures, let’s briefly review common monitoring equipment types. This understanding is crucial for selecting the right equipment and interpreting its data.

A. Closed-Circuit Television (CCTV) Cameras: These are the most ubiquitous form of monitoring equipment. They range from simple analog cameras to sophisticated IP cameras offering high-resolution video, night vision, and pan-tilt-zoom (PTZ) capabilities. They require power and, often, network connectivity.

B. Environmental Sensors: These monitor various environmental conditions like temperature, humidity, pressure, and light levels. They are frequently used in industrial settings, data centers, and smart homes. Different sensors utilize various communication protocols (e.g., wired, wireless, Bluetooth).

C. Network Monitoring Tools: These tools, often software-based, monitor network performance, traffic, and security. They can detect bottlenecks, intrusions, and other anomalies. These often require specialized knowledge to configure and interpret.

II. Setting up a Basic CCTV System:

A. Camera Placement: Strategic camera placement is critical. Consider areas requiring heightened security, blind spots, and optimal viewing angles. Ensure adequate lighting, especially for night vision cameras.

B. Cable Routing: Route cables neatly and securely, avoiding sharp bends or potential damage. Use appropriate cable management solutions to maintain organization and prevent tripping hazards.

C. Connection to DVR/NVR: Connect the cameras to a Digital Video Recorder (DVR) or Network Video Recorder (NVR) using coaxial cables (for analog cameras) or network cables (for IP cameras). Refer to your specific DVR/NVR's instructions for detailed connection procedures.

D. Software Configuration: Configure the DVR/NVR software to set recording schedules, motion detection sensitivity, and other parameters based on your specific needs. Many systems offer remote access via mobile apps.

III. Setting up Environmental Sensors:

A. Sensor Placement: Position sensors in locations that accurately represent the conditions you want to monitor. Avoid obstructions and consider factors like air circulation and direct sunlight.

B. Power Connection: Connect the sensors to a power source according to the manufacturer's specifications. Some sensors operate on batteries, while others require a direct power connection.

C. Data Logging and Analysis: Many sensors allow data logging either directly on the device or via a connected computer. Utilize appropriate software to analyze the collected data, identify trends, and generate reports.

IV. Troubleshooting Common Issues:

A. CCTV Issues: No image, poor image quality, or connectivity problems are common. Check cable connections, power supply, camera settings, and network configuration. Consult the manufacturer's troubleshooting guide for specific issues.

B. Sensor Issues: Inaccurate readings, sensor malfunctions, or data transmission errors can occur. Verify sensor calibration, power supply, and communication protocols. Replace faulty sensors as needed.

C. Network Monitoring Issues: Slow network speeds, security breaches, or software glitches can disrupt network monitoring. Regularly update software, monitor network traffic, and implement appropriate security measures.

V. Safety Precautions:

Always follow manufacturer instructions and safety guidelines when installing and using monitoring equipment. Ensure proper grounding, avoid electrical hazards, and use appropriate personal protective equipment (PPE) when necessary. Consult with qualified professionals for complex installations or if you encounter difficulties.
